by Jesse L. Byock (Author)

The history of medieval Europe is incomplete if it does not take Iceland into account. Jesse Byock's reassessment of medieval Iceland uses all the available sources-the medieval Icelanders' historical writings, extensive saga literature, and intricate laws-to explore the way Iceland's social order functioned.

Author Biography

Jesse L. Byock teaches Old Norse and medieval Scandinavian subjects at the University of California, Los Angeles and is the author of Feud in the Icelandic Saga (1982).
